Default Problem uninstalling XM Radio

Hi all - new guy here....I searched the forum first before starting this thread...

I recently attempted to install a program to listen to XM Radio...it didn't seem to work, so I went to uninstall it. There is no "Uninstall" option in the program, so I went to Start/Settings/Remove programs. XM Radio does not appear in the list. I went to File Explorer and tried to delete it manually, but I get an error message, saying "The file XMRadio is a system file. If you remove it, your device or programs may no longer work correctly. Are you sure you want to delete it?" I hit yes and get an error saying "Cannot delete XMRadio: Access is denied. I also tried to delete the folder via Total Commander - same problem.

I am trying to clean up my device, and this one is being difficult. Any help would be appreciated.

make sure the program is not running
run the task manager and kill the app should it be running

if you delete it from the file manager then there will be left over items
you can download and install SKtools this will clean up any left over items left behind

Thanks - I did verify that the program was not runnning using the Task Manager (it was not running).

I attempted to uninstall the program using "Remove Programs", but it doesn't appear on the list of installed programs.

Then I attempted to uninstall it using the "Add/Remove Programs" tool in ActiveSync. It also does not appear in the list of installed programs.

Then, using both File Explorer and Total Commander, I can see the program installed in a folder called "/Program Files/XMRadio", but the device won't let me uninstall it.

EDIT: BTW, I DID try SK Tools to no avail....

Am I looking at a hard reset?

try to remove any 'system' properties on the files so you can delete them
if not then im not sure what...perhaps you just leave it and no uninstall...as long as its not in the way just leave it
